Ingredients List
For 4 hearty servings of irresistible Cajun Chicken Sloppy Joes, gather:
- 1 lb ground chicken (substitute: ground turkey or plant-based crumbles for a vegetarian option)
- 1 tbsp olive oil (or avocado oil for a neutral, healthy swap)
- 1 large onion, finely chopped (sweet, yellow, or red—all work!)
- 1 green bell pepper, diced (sub with red or yellow for color variation)
- 3 garlic cloves, minced (use garlic paste for convenience)
- 2 tbsp Cajun seasoning (adjust for heat; homemade or store-bought)
- 1/2 tsp smoked paprika (adds depth—optional but recommended)
- 1 cup tomato sauce (crushed tomatoes or passata work too)
- 2 tbsp tomato paste (for a rich, umami punch)
- 2 tbsp Worcestershire sauce (adds tang—use soy sauce for a vegan touch)
- 1 tbsp brown sugar (or maple syrup for a refined sugar-free version)
- 1/2 cup low-sodium chicken broth (vegetable broth for vegetarian)
- Salt & pepper, to taste
- 4 brioche hamburger buns (or gluten-free buns; whole grain for extra fiber)

Step-by-Step Instructions
Step 1: Sauté the Aromatics
Heat olive oil in a large skillet over medium-high. Add chopped onions and bell peppers. Sauté for 3-4 minutes, stirring occasionally, until soft and fragrant. Add the garlic in the last minute to prevent burning.
Tip: A pinch of salt helps vegetables sweat faster!
Step 2: Brown the Chicken
Push veggies to the side; add ground chicken to the center. Let it sear undisturbed for 2-3 minutes, then break apart and cook until no longer pink.
Trick: Don’t over-stir—the caramelized edges add massive flavor.
Step 3: Fold in the Cajun Flavors
Sprinkle in Cajun seasoning and smoked paprika. Stir well. Toasting the spices for 1 minute amps up their earthy, smoky undertones.
Step 4: Simmer with Saucy Goodness
Stir in tomato sauce, tomato paste, Worcestershire, brown sugar, and broth. Bring to a gentle boil, then reduce heat. Simmer uncovered for 10-12 minutes, until thick and glossy.
Tip: If you prefer saucier Joes, splash in extra broth or tomato sauce.
Step 5: Assemble and Serve
Toast brioche buns for crunch. Spoon a heaping pile of spicy Cajun chicken onto each bun. Top with cheese or fresh herbs if desired. Serve immediately and savor every bite!

Common Mistakes to Avoid
- Overcooking the chicken: Leads to dryness—simmer until just cooked through.
- Too much liquid: Results in soggy buns; simmer until thickened.
- Unbalanced seasoning: Cajun blends vary, so taste and adjust salt and spice.
- Skipping toasting the buns: Toasted buns prevent sogginess and add texture.
- Using the wrong meat: Dark meat or high-fat mixes can be greasy.

Storing Tips for the Recipe
- Refrigerator: Store leftover Cajun chicken filling in an airtight container for up to 4 days.
- Freezer: Freeze in portioned containers for up to 2 months; thaw overnight in the fridge.
- Reheat: Gently rewarm on the stove, adding a splash of broth to loosen.
- Prepping ahead: Make the filling 1-2 days in advance for effortless assembly.
- Separate storage: Store buns separately to maintain texture.
For optimal freshness and flavor, assemble just before serving.
